Vesuviusâ„¢ is the largest shaped charge produced by Alford Technologies. As Vesuviusâ„¢ is based on our smaller Krakatoaâ„¢ charge, it has been designed to be a user-filled modular charge that is supplied in kit form. All that the operator needs to add is plastic explosive, a detonator and a bit of imagination. The main body of Vesuviusâ„¢ is approximately 160 mm long and 160 mm in diameter. Because of the mass of plastic explosive that is required - approximately 4 kg - it is recommended that Vesuviusâ„¢ be mounted on a sturdy mini-tripod for greater accuracy when aiming at targets. A half load explosive charge may also be used, by the use of an additional sabot, with a loss of only 25% in performance. Apart from the projectiles, no metal components are used in the construction of the charge container. This allows a greater level of confidence to the user that the threat of lethal fragments will remain low. Vesuviusâ„¢ may be used for explosive engineering, demolition and Explosive Ordnance Disposal (EOD), in particular against buried munitions. As this charge has similar proportions to many insurgent EFP's, Vesuviusâ„¢ has been used to assess current and new armor protection levels in today's warfare.
